Barlow Crossing to Keeps Mill Info
Use this information at your own risk. See our legal notices.
Put In:  Barlow Crossing
Take Out:  Keeps Mill
Difficulty:  Class III , Class IV
Gradient:  50 fpm
Run Length:  6 miles
Good Level:  400 - 1,400 cfs
Streamflow Comments:  There is no gauge for the White River. Usually runnable after a few days of warm weather on Mt. Hood.
Season Comments:  April, May, June
Primary Season:  Snowmelt season
Permit:  None presently required
Character/Similar To:  This run starts in a scenic forested gorge and ends in the desert. Most of this section is class I+ but has a few fun class III/IV twisty drops.
Hazards:  In the upper section there is lots of wood. So much wood has accumulated that this run is very hazardous and in most cases not very enjoyable.
Water Craft:  kayak,wwcan
Land Ownership:  Public forest land
Wilderness:  Yes
Location:  In the Pacific Region (OR), 112 miles (2 hours 16 minutes) East of Salem
Shuttle Logistics: 

Take Out: From Portland take US 26 until OR 216.Turn east onto OR 216 toward Maupin, in 3 miles look for the sign to Keeps Mill/White River. Turn left and follow the main road to the river, the last 1.5 miles of the road are very rocky and slow.

Put In: From the take out return to OR 26 and turn north. Turn north onto Oregon 35 toward Mt. Hood; in a few miles take another right onto National Forest Road 43. In a few miles this road will cross the river, put in below the bridge at Barlow Crossing.
